About Architectural Panel Products Industries
Architectural Panel Products Industries, LLC.(APPI) is a custom manufacturer of pre-finished and unfinished, high-quality wood veneer panels. Our products incorporate both domestic and exotic wood veneers from around the globe, delivering you the versatile range of styles you need for a successful project. Meticulous quality, consistency and dependability are core values for APPI and set us apart

What Is the Cost of Living Near West Palm Beach?

Understanding the cost of living near West Palm Beach is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Architectural Panel Products Industries.
West Palm Beach's Cost of Living Index is approximately 113.8 (13.8% more expensive than US average; 10.4% more than FL average). South Florida city, higher housing costs, near affluent Palm Beach. Palm Tran, Tri-Rail. When planning your budget based on a salary from Architectural Panel Products Industries,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,700 - $2,600+ A significant portion of Architectural Panel Products Industries sal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$170 - $280 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$70 (Palm Tran mon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$430 - $650 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$430 - $800+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$390 - $730+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$3,190 - $5,060+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
